Rugby school selections
Seven Cantabrians are among the 120 Rugby players selected to attend the fourth annual national coaching school for promising young players at Lincoln College next Easter. All 26 provincial unions will be represented at the school, which once again will be under the direction of the former All Black captain, Mr R. C. Stuart. Auckland, with nine, has the largest contingent.
The Canterbury players are M. S. Wheeler, full-back; S. M. McKinley, wing; S. Bloomberg, half-back; R. J. Hammersley, flanker; K. F. Johnston, lock; B J. Newfield, prop; and M. A. Johnston, hooker.
